A nonconvex approach to low-rank and sparse matrix decomposition with application to video surveillance. (arXiv:1807.01276v1 [math.OC])
来源于:arXiv
In this paper, we develop a new nonconvex approach to the problem of low-rank
and sparse matrix decomposition. In our nonconvex method, we replace the rank
function and the $\ell_{0}$-norm of a given matrix with a non-convex fraction
function on the singular values and the elements of the matrix respectively. An
alternative direction method of multipliers algorithm is utilized to solve our
nonconvex problem with the non-convex fraction function penalty. Numerical
experiments on video surveillance show that our method performs very well in
